Windward Community College

School Overview

The school's main campus is located at the edge of a large city (in Kaneohe, HI). The maximum program length is 2 to 4 years. The highest degree offered by the school is the Associate's degree.

Student Body Size and Diversity

In Fall 2002, the school had 1,151 (full-time equivalent) students.

Minority enrollment included African-American (1)%, Hispanic (3)%, Asian (65)%, and Native American (1)%.

Windward Community College is a Minority Serving Institution as defined by the Office of Civil Rights.

School Accreditation

Windward Community College is accredited regionally by the Western Association of Schools and Colleges, Accrediting Commission for Community and Junior Colleges (WASCJC).
